Does a witch in wicked have a sister in a wheelchair?

Yes, Elphaba (the wicked witch of the west)'s sister Nessarose (the wicked witch of the east) is in a wheelchair at the beginning of the show. however in Act II, Elphaba enchants her shoes (thus creating the ruby slippers) allowing her to walk.

What happens to fiyero in wicked?

Okay... So lets start from act 2. Fiyero is now a gaurd for Oz and has just helped Elphaba escape, to protect her because he loves her and not glinda. The other gaurds that were trying to kill her take Fiyero to a field and "demand to tell them where the witch went". Knowing that Fiyero will die Elphaba casts a spell in "no good deed" hoping to save him. She thinks that the spell did not work, but at the end of the musical, we see Fiyero survived and has become the scarecrow.

Is the wicked witch of the west dedd?

Yes, in The Wizard of Oz; yes and no, in Wicked. Author and Oz series originator Lyman Frank Baum [May 15, 1856-May 5, 1919] explained that the land of Oz had been taken over by four bad witches of the East, North, South, and West. Two of the bad witches had been replaced by the Good Witch of the North, and by Glinda the Good Witch of the South. Dorothy's house landed on, and killed, the Wicked Witch of the East. That left only the Wicked Witch of the West, whom Dorothy killed with a bucket of water. Gregory Maguire [b. June 9, 1954] is one of the writers who have made contributions to the Oz series since the death of the originator. His book Wicked, on which the play of the same name is based, creates a background of abusive interactions, and a life of emotional disappointments, that had their effect on the evolving character of the Wicked Witch of the West, whom he calls Elphaba Thropp.

Did 'Wicked' win a Tony for best musical?

No, "Wicked" didn't win a Tony for best musical.

Specifically, the winning categories instead were in designs of costumes and set, and in leading performance. In 2004, Susan Hilferty was the successful nominee for Best Costume Design. Who stars in Wicked?

The original cast of 'Wicked: The Musical' on Broadway was:

Elphaba: Idina Menzel

Glinda: Kristin Chenoweth

Fiyero: Norbert Leo Butz

Nessarose: Michelle Federer

Boq: Christopher Fitzgerald

Madame Morible: Carole Shelley

The Wonderful Wizard of Oz: Joel Grey
